Original Description
Keeley Halswelle’s Banks of the Ouse (1864) is a tranquil yet evocative example of 19th-century British landscape painting, embodying the delicate naturalism of the Victorian era. The scene captures a serene moment along the River Ouse, with soft sunlight filtering through the trees and dappling the water’s surface—a masterful play of light and shadow that reflects Halswelle’s academic training and affinity for atmospheric detail. Though less radical than his Impressionist contemporaries, Halswelle’s precise yet poetic style bridges traditional realism and emerging plein-air sensibilities. This work, like many of his river scenes, holds historical significance as a document of England’s vanishing pastoral landscapes amid industrialization, offering a nostalgic counterpoint to modernity. Its balanced composition and subtle tonal harmonies place it within the lineage of British Romanticism, recalling Constable’s reverence for nature while anticipating the subdued palette of the Glasgow Boys.
